Cheap and reliable
I've known the 2013 Ford Fiesta SE for the last 10 years, got it new back in 2013, it's at 168,300+ miles at the moment. Not fancy by any means, but the seating isn't bad if you're under 6 feet tall, for example I'm 5'5" and I have decent leg room and headroom, no one else but the driver gets an armrest, for entertainment it has Bluetooth and the speakers are nice, it gets the job done of going from A to B safely without costing an arm and a leg. Small eco cars of course may not favor well in accidents but that's countered by the cheap value, which is great for safe drivers who may not have deep pockets. 35MPG with 12 gallon tank gets you roughly 400 miles full at the 15K price range these days while being fairly reliable, can't really be beat. Only thing I've had to do is change out an electrical board piece, the caliper belt, brakes, battery and the tires, but that's just what it takes to keep a vehicle going long term. One thing I have noticed though is that the transmission has a tough time changing gears when you're at a stop and trying to accelerate out of the first gear, but after that it's smooth sailing. It's been doing that no worse or better for at least a year now, just a quirk at this point. Don't wanna waste any big money on a big part like that if it only happens in low speed conditions where it's safe to be quirky.

Great manual transmission car
Back in 2014 I visited the Ford dealership in Brownsville, Texas to purchase a Ford Fiesta with a manual transmission. They only had automatic ones. I went to another Ford dealership and they had one Ford Fiesta with a manual transmission. I bought it. I will now discuss the bad and the good. One issue I had was the timing belt tensioner. It was bent at 75,000 miles. Luckily I had the timing belt removed on time. When I had uhaul install the hitch I noticed the design in the rear frame was poorly made by Ford to the point towing was not an option. I took my car to a welding shop and had all that rear area reinforced super strong. Now the good. Aside from those 2 issues my Ford Fiesta has been extremely reliable. Currently it has over 168,000 miles. And within those miles I have driven basically all over the USA occassionally towing another car. Overall, the Ford Fiesta is an awesome car on the condition you maintain it and make sure you get one with a manual transmission. The automatic Ford Fiestas are garbage because of a defective transmission.

Fun car that is hard to choose wrong!
As a mechanic I have owned two Fiesta's, and worked on several. Particularly the Fiesta ST - these are some of my favorite cars. Its easy to work on for a small car and parts are cheap. I have seen people do minor mods to make them wicked fast but best of all - they are generally bulletproof inside and out. It is amazing how many VWs I have seen with busted strut towers, Mazda's with leaking sunroofs or soft tops, but the Fiesta's are rocket ships that only have issues when the owner does something stupid. The 6-speed transmissions are really great - i have yet to need to do a clutch or fly wheel repair or see any issues there really. Turbos are good for 200k miles it seems. The automatic transmission in older ones can suck - avoid those. Take good care of these cars and they will take care of you. Ford's best product in years. Dont get a Focus ST - get the Fiesta.

Good bang for the buck; electronics issues.
I bought this car from a dealer in 2018 with 9.5K miles on it. It was previously owned by an employee executive in that business. The car in 2023 now has 93K miles on it. Issues I've had: 1) Horn failed 2) Heating/Defrost Vent Solenoid failed twice. 3) APIM (Bluetooth connectivity) failed. The engine has been solid. The transmission has been solid. (reworked for the 2017 model year). Cooling has been fine. Radio has great reception and sounds good. For me (5-9", 235 lbs) the front bucket seats are comfortable. I've used the back seat fold down feature several times to transport items I thought would not fit inside the car.

What is the MPG of the Ford Fiesta?
The Ford Fiesta with traditional internal combustion engine offers up to 29 MPG city and 38 MPG highway for a combined rating of 33 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le model year, tr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
